Bracelet

Nubian
Classic Kerma
about 1700–1550 B.C.
Findspot: Nubia (Sudan), Kerma, K 1065:28

Medium/Technique Ivory or horn
Dimensions Height x diameter: 1.3 x 5.8 cm (1/2 x 2 5/16 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number13.4218
NOT ON VIEW

DescriptionThe outer face of this cuff bracelet id decorated with horizontal incised bands. The ends taper and are pierced.
ProvenanceFrom Kerma, tumulus X, grave 1065 (1065:28). 1913: excavated by the Harvard University–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A in the division of finds by the government of Sudan.

(Accession date: December 4, 1913)
